Toning Exercises Toning Exercises to look younger, fitter and more beautiful. Doing toning exercises regularly will increase your beauty in many ways and make you look younger. Toning exercises that raise your heart rate are good for your cardio-vascular system, blood will be pumped around your system and your whole body will benefit. It's a well known fact that if you keep your body toned and active then you will slow down the aging process and you are also less likely to become frail and weak as you grow older. Toned and supple muscles add to your quality of movement, you will become more balanced and therefore more beautiful. Streamline your body  Toning exercises can be done with or without weights, depending on your present level of fitness. I find starting a new exercise without weights is best, and then progress to using weights when you can do the exercises easily without them. I use the York 10kg Vinyl Fitbell Kit in a Case because you get three sets of different weights in one kit. This means I can vary the weights according to the toning exercises I'm doing and it also means I can increase the resistance as I get stronger and fitter. I've found these weights ideal because they're easy to hold and use. Do not over do it. A strained or pulled muscle will take time to heal and set your fitness program back. It’s always best to start slow and build up your strength and stamina as time goes on. Always build on what you have already accomplished, pushing yourself just a little bit further every time you do your toning exercises. Toning Exercises for Your Whole Body Star Jumps are an easy exercise to start with; this will help to increase your heart rate and stamina.
